Snorkeling at Akumal Beach

Guests can expect to snorkel along the vibrant reef at Akumal Beach, where they’ll have the chance to encounter a variety of marine life, including the area’s famous sea turtles.
The snorkeling equipment provided on the tour will allow them to explore the underwater world and witness the turtles’ natural behavior up close.
The warm, clear waters of Akumal Beach offer excellent visibility, making it easy to spot the turtles as they gracefully swim by.
Guests are advised to move slowly and avoid approaching the turtles too closely to minimize disturbance to these protected creatures.
The snorkeling activity is sure to be a highlight of the tour, providing a immersive and unforgettable experience in the Caribbean.
Exploring the Cenote Cave

After exploring the vibrant reef at Akumal Beach, guests will venture to a nearby cenote cave, where they can enjoy the refreshing, crystal-clear waters.
These natural sinkholes, formed by the collapse of limestone bedrock, offer a unique opportunity to swim in a serene, underground environment. The tour guide will provide snorkeling gear and lead the group through the cavern, pointing out the stunning stalactites and stalagmites that adorn the cave walls.
Guests can swim freely, taking in the tranquil atmosphere and cooling off from the warm Caribbean sun. This cenote experience is a highlight of the tour, providing a chance to discover the incredible natural wonders that lie beneath the surface.
